Odd one this.......

Over at a friends and posting from their machine connected directly to the SACM and the internet works fine however.

A few days ago they bought a wireless router ZyXEL one and set it up working fine and dandy. Tonight they could get no web pages at all had a look in the router config's and the WAN port was issued with 192.168.100.10 instead of a public IP ??

Spoofing the MAC/rebooting modem and router etc has made no difference. Whenever the router is connected it gets the above address, the ready light flashes like mad and in the SACM Operation log it shows as Network access = denied ?

In the Middlesbrough area if that makes any difference ??
